Supreme Court of India

Commissioner of Service Tax Etc. v. M/s. Bhayana Builders (p) Ltd. Etc.

Neutral citation
Reported as [2018] 1 S.C.R. 1128
Bench A. K. Sikri and Ashok Bhushan JJ.
Decided 19 February 2018

From the headnote

Finance Act, 1994 – s. 65(105)(zzq) and 67 – Service tax – On construct ion services – Valuation of taxable service – By Notifi cation dated 10.9.2004, service tax was to be calculated on the value equivale nt to 33% of the ‘gross amount charged’ from any perso n by such commercial concern for providing taxable service – This Not ification was further amended by Notification dated 1.3.2005 whereby it was explained that ‘gross amount charged’ shall include the value of goods and materials supplied and provided or used by the pr ovider of construction service for providing such service – In the
